This study aims to explore how Omani companies can enhance international cooperation amid global economic shifts and domestic challenges. A qualitative research approach was employed, incorporating case studies, government reports, and trade data to assess the capacity of Omani firms—particularly SMEs—to engage in international markets. The study analyzed trade barriers, regulatory frameworks, and bilateral/multilateral agreements. Findings reveal that Oman possesses abundant mineral resources (e.g., copper, zinc, cobalt), and its companies have the potential to leverage these through international collaboration. However, SMEs face constraints due to complex regulations, high interest rates, logistical inefficiencies, and limited market access. Programs like Omanization and Riyadh have yielded mixed results, particularly for SME growth. The study concludes that simplifying trade policies, enhancing logistics infrastructure, and expanding bilateral and multilateral agreements are essential for boosting Oman’s international business cooperation.
